Small Animal Dentistry
Publisher Description
Many important improvements have been made in the science and practice of dentistry in small animal practice over the last decade. These have included updates in terminology used to identify an animal’s teeth, the incorporation of digital radiography in the diagnosis of different dental abnormalities, the development of a comprehensive series of protocols used to completely evaluate, treat and prevent dental diseases in dogs and cats, and the use of specific nerve blocks as a mean to improve provision of analgesia in veterinary patients. This interactive book was developed to highlight these improvements.
